Hey Marisol,

Handing over the rotation tool (we call it Keyturner) before my leave. It cycles service creds nightly and logs every swap to the audit store. Ravi reviewed the cron wiring last sprint, so that part's solid. For your review, you'll mostly care about where the rotation ledger lives. It connects using the string below.

warehouse DSN: mssql://druius_svc:aJ@db-b2f3.xolmarhq.local:5432/soreth

Handover: Bakery Cutoff Rule

Passing the Ovenline cutoff service to you. It blocks same-day orders placed after the morning bake starts; the Millbrook shop has an earlier cutoff than the others. Most tickets are customers confused by timezone handling. Nothing is pending. The service currently runs with the following configuration.

deployment values, kajep-kageg:
[praix]
host = praix.paliqcorp.corp
user = praix_svc
database = praix_prod

CI note: per-tenant rate quotas on Kestrelgate. If a tenant's pipeline stalls at the quota gate, check the quota ledger job first — it resets hourly, not per-run. Don't bump limits manually; file a change with the Platform crew. Most "flaky" failures here are just quota exhaustion from parallel fan-out. Reproduce with the staging tenant before escalating. Reference the trace token from the failing gate step, shown below.

build token for kagaf-hahof: htk14_9d3d4d26d7d8de

Subject: Quickstore 4.2 — bloom filter now fronts the KV layer

Plugin authors: starting with this release, Quickstore places a bloom filter ahead of the key-value store. Negative lookups return faster; false positives fall through safely. No API changes are required on your side. Verify your plugin against the staging build referenced below.

session token of fahif-tadup = htk3_9c7